WebRTC交叉编译的跨平台能力
在当今互联网技术飞速发展的时代,WebRTC(Web Real-Time Communication)作为一种实时通信技术,已经成为了跨平台应用开发的热门选择。本文将深入探讨WebRTC交叉编译的跨平台能力,为您揭示其在不同操作系统上的应用优势。
WebRTC概述
WebRTC是一种开放的网络通信技术,允许网页和应用程序直接进行实时通信,无需服务器中转。它支持音视频通信、文件传输等多种功能,广泛应用于在线教育、远程医疗、在线游戏等领域。
WebRTC交叉编译
WebRTC交叉编译是指将WebRTC源代码编译成适用于不同操作系统的可执行文件。通过交叉编译,WebRTC可以在不同平台上运行,实现跨平台能力。
WebRTC交叉编译的优势
跨平台支持:WebRTC交叉编译使得开发者可以轻松地将应用程序移植到不同操作系统,如Windows、macOS、Linux、Android和iOS等。
提高开发效率:交叉编译可以减少重复的开发工作,节省开发时间和成本。
优化性能:通过针对不同平台进行优化,WebRTC交叉编译可以提高应用程序的性能。
兼容性更强:WebRTC交叉编译支持多种浏览器和设备,提高了应用程序的兼容性。
案例分析
以在线教育平台为例,该平台采用WebRTC技术实现音视频实时通信。通过交叉编译,该平台可以在Windows、macOS、Linux、Android和iOS等操作系统上运行,满足不同用户的需求。
总结
WebRTC交叉编译的跨平台能力为开发者提供了极大的便利,使得应用程序可以在不同平台上运行,提高开发效率和兼容性。随着WebRTC技术的不断发展,其在跨平台应用开发中的应用将越来越广泛。
猜你喜欢:海外直播专线的价格